About (3-aminooxan-3-yl)methanol

(3-aminooxan-3-yl)methanol (PubChem CID 18316253) has the molecular formula C6H13NO2 and a molecular weight of 131.17 g/mol. Its IUPAC name is (3-aminooxan-3-yl)methanol.
